Flameshot is an open source screenshot software for Linux. It has annotation and markup tools to add text, shapes, colors etc. to screenshots. It allows uploading images to Imgur and copy to clipboard easily.
Markup Hero is a lightweight yet powerful markup and documentation tool. It allows you to easily write, preview and export clean, valid markup for websites, ebooks, and more in various formats like HTML, Markdown, JSON, and YAML.
